Transaction 24d146d3b17cbf90cef62cecb29ad4e449d76fd0b4ea325136a14a9091bde879
1 Input
1 Output
-
24d146d3b17cbf90cef62cecb29ad4e449d76fd0b4ea325136a14a9091bde879:0
- value
- 594910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9a02ccbb3af7b0d01812e0a2ae175e719e7b643 OP_EQUAL
- address
- 3L57dFimLsakaadZ39VBWM9WL6opJXGc4t